Some plants have stems called
inna [77]

Answer:

Runners

Explanation:

stems are usually upright and prop up the plant to gather sunlight, however, some stems grow along the ground. These stems are called runners and the plant itself is called a stolon. Runners are involved in asexual reproduction of plants. They have nodes along them which can grow into another plant.

Which is the name of the carbohydrate formed during photosynthesis ?
Tanzania [10]

Answer:

Glucose

Explanation:

Photosynthesis requires sunlight, carbon dioxide and water to produce glucose. This simple sugar is a carbohydrate that combines with other sugars to form the plant's structure and stores energy for future use. Hope it's useful!
